How the ETS Magazine Loader Works
This Gen II loader is engineered around a centered system that automatically positions your magazine's feed lips properly. You insert the mag, load it directly from an ammo tray or grab a handful of loose rounds, and use the plunger to push them in rapidly. The design handles both single and double stack magazines without any adjustments needed. Most people can load a full magazine in less than 10 seconds once they get the hang of it.

Frequently Asked Questions
Will the ETS magazine loader work with my specific pistol?
This loader works with virtually all standard 9mm and .40 S&W pistol magazines. However, it does not work with STI 2011, Taurus PT709, Bersa Thunder .380, Walther CCP, Sig P938, Makarov 9×18, Springfield Armory Hellcat, Steyr C9-A1, or any magazine larger than a standard double stack 9mm mag. If you own one of those specific models, check compatibility before purchasing.

How steep is the learning curve with this speed loader?
Most users pick it up after a few attempts. Once you get comfortable with the mechanics, you'll load magazines much faster than by hand. Some folks notice that new magazines with stiffer springs require a break-in period, and applying light gun oil to the ramps can make the final rounds in high capacity mags load more smoothly.
Can I load rounds from an ammo box directly, or do I need a loading tray?
You can do either. The loader works with a loaded ammo tray or with loose rounds from a box. Some people use an ammo block or tray to keep rounds oriented properly, while others grab a handful of loose ammunition and load directly from their hand or an open box.
